The Issue Need to measure BTEX in water streams at low levels –Wastewater and Cooling Water –5 to 50 ppb –Current technologies costly (50 to 200 k$) Sparger IR or GC; Membrane MS Enhanced measurement in air for environmental and industrial hygiene also desirable
Novel Approach Sensors based on smart materials capable of extracting BTEX
Proposal Objectives: –Selection of polymers for analyte enrichment; –Development of improved materials based on nano-particle doped polymers or sols. –Determination of enrichment profiles (time and concentration) of aromatic compounds –Development and optimization of spectroscopic detection; –Optical design and optimization; –Design of a dedicated laboratory-sensing instrument. Deliverables: –Novel material design for BTEX determinations –Lab based sensing system ready for commercial development Principle Investigator: –Dr. Fiona Regan; Dublin City University Cost: –80,000 Euro Total –PERF/QUESTOR cost sharing - TBN
